The Bazar Tent

The Bazar Tent

Now this is what you can truly call camping out in style! Called the Bazar Tent, the creation was really meant for social gatherings. But if you can afford it (price undisclosed unfortunately), this is one cool tent to have when you spend the night outdoors or simply want to rough it.

The Bazar Tent is a brainchild of Lambert Kamps and is made of inflatable bags. Individual airbags are sewn together like bricks to create this tent.
